What You Will Do

Investor engagement - Serve as a key point of contact for US-based investors and analysts alongside the head of IR in Stockholm.

Conduct one-one-meetings and conference calls, build and maintain relationships in the investor community.

Investor marketing materials - Develop, write, and edit high-quality investor presentations, quarterly earnings releases and other marketing materials and reports towards investors.

Stay updated on industry trends, market conditions and competitor analysis to effectively position the company’s narrative.

  • Event coordination - Plan, coordinate and execute investor roadshows and conference attendance in the US.
  • Data analysis and reporting - Monitor and analyze market trends, investor sentiment and stock performance to provide actionable insights to senior management.

Prepare and distribute summaries of market feedback, investor activity and stock performance.

Compliance and best practice - Ensure all communications and disclosures comply with regulatory requirements, including SEC regulations and stock exchange rules.

Who You Are

  • 5+ years of experience in investor relations, capital markets (investor or research analyst), preferably within the tech or payments sectors.
  • Proven experience engaging with institutional investors and analysts.
  • Exceptional commun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to articulate complex financial and strategic information clearly and concisely.
  • Strong analytical skills and attention to detail.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ment and manage multiple priorities simultaneously.
